Abstract

Dielectric and pyroelectric properties of ceramics PbZr1-xTixO3 (PZT) in the concentration range 0.01<x<0.08 were investigate. As a matter of record it was found that in the PZT there is a region wherein appear three inhevent for the entire family of perovskite instabilities of original cubic lattice. It is shown that the antiferroelectric phase in PZT exists up to x=0.07. Studies of a composition with x = 0.08 in the temperature range -200ºC<T<300ºC had not revealed existence of antiferroelectric phase that makes evident the existence of vertical boundary between the Pbam and R3c phases.
